s

Nawal Ali Ahmed Alhaji Alameer

Shop Number
1060
Telephone
36633145
View Details
s

Natural Blends

Shop Number
1221
Telephone
32197474
View Details
s

Naranj for general trading and contracting Co W.L.L.

Shop Number
1095
Telephone
39771128
View Details
s

Noor Al Fajer Fresh Fish

Shop Number
1407
Telephone
39679967
View Details
s

Nayef Sweets

Shop Number
1397
Telephone
39938845-39951495
View Details